Laminak Rev-Up Consultant Elite

creature

Small (crow-sized) fat fairies resembling 40-something soccer moms, inverted bob haircuts, leaf-material pantsuits/dresses; hummingbird wings trailing sparkles, bobbing flight.

The Laminak Rev-Up Consultant Elite are introduced in the first book of the Dungeon Crawler Carl series as small, crow-sized fairies resembling harried 40-something soccer moms, clad in leaf-material pantsuits and dresses, with inverted bob haircuts and hummingbird wings that trail sparkles during their bobbing flight. These quirky entities serve as high-level consultants, injecting frantic energy into the dungeon's chaotic crawler ecosystem. Across the series, they remain a memorable, unchanging fixture of the game's absurd bureaucracy, symbolizing the Syndicate's blend of corporate drudgery and fantastical whimsy, though their specific interventions do not evolve beyond their debut appearance.
